Output 88298d93fe2ed62737dae49532c36fcda265d2040e5df540bcba6313477d7f17:10

value
4205900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ec30c7d434a078b901c6b33952e543581cd93b20 OP_EQUAL
address
3PDsq9eky3hejhBLWbpeh4EDn6zxoGAh5p
transaction
88298d93fe2ed62737dae49532c36fcda265d2040e5df540bcba6313477d7f17
confirmations
261111
spent
true